How they compare
Ukraine currently reports 23.7% against 23.5% in Belgium, a difference of 0.2%.
Across all 6 years both countries report, Ukraine has been ahead every year.
Belgium ranks 63rd and Ukraine ranks 61st of 178 countries.
Ukraine has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Belgium | Ukraine |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 29.0% | 39.6% | 10.6% | Ukraine |
| 2010s | 26.4% | 31.2% | 4.9% | Ukraine |
| 2020s | 24.0% | 24.9% | 0.9% | Ukraine |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
